Ingredients
Scale
- 2 packages (1 ounce, each) dry onion soup mix
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- 2 pounds beef stew meat, or a boneless beef roast, cut in 1-inch pieces
- 5 medium potatoes, peeled and diced
- 2 to 3 cups baby carrots
- 1 small yellow onion, chopped
- 2 cans (10 ounces, each) cream of celery soup
- 1 cup ketchup (or substitute tomato sauce)
Instructions
- In a large plastic bag, combine the dry onion soup mix and paprika. Add in the beef and shake to coat. Work in batches if needed.
- Spread the coated meat evenly in a greased 7-quart crock pot. Add the diced potatoes, baby carrots, and chopped onion on top.
- In a small bowl, mix together the cream of celery soup and ketchup. Pour the mixture over the beef and vegetables.
- Cover and cook on low for 7–8 hours, or until the meat is tender and the vegetables are soft.
- Stir everything together before serving.
Notes
- Replace ketchup with tomato sauce if preferred.
- For a thicker stew, remove the lid during the last 30 minutes of cooking.
- Serve with crusty bread for a complete meal.
